怎样实现"java根据路径得到file"
整体流程
首先,我们需要明确整体的流程,然后再逐步分解每个步骤所需的操作和代码。在这里,我将使用表格展示整个流程的步骤:
步骤 | 操作 |
---|---|
1 | 创建File对象 |
2 | 获取路径字符串 |
3 | 根据路径字符串创建File对象 |
4 | 判断File对象是否存在 |
5 | 输出File对象的信息 |
详细步骤及代码
步骤1:创建File对象
首先,我们需要创建一个File对象。在Java中,可以通过File类来表示文件或目录。下面是相应的代码:
// 创建一个File对象
File file = new File("");
步骤2:获取路径字符串
接下来,我们需要获取路径字符串,即文件或目录的路径。可以通过File对象的getPath()方法来获取路径字符串:
// 获取路径字符串
String path = file.getPath();
步骤3:根据路径字符串创建File对象
现在,我们可以根据路径字符串创建一个新的File对象。这样我们就可以通过路径字符串得到一个File对象。下面是相应的代码:
// 根据路径字符串创建File对象
File newFile = new File(path);
步骤4:判断File对象是否存在
在得到新的File对象后,我们可以通过exists()方法来判断该File对象所表示的文件或目录是否存在。
// 判断File对象是否存在
if(newFile.exists()) {
System.out.println("File exists.");
} else {
System.out.println("File does not exist.");
}
步骤5:输出File对象的信息
最后,我们可以输出File对象的一些信息,比如文件名、绝对路径等。
// 输出File对象的信息
System.out.println("File name: " + newFile.getName());
System.out.println("Absolute path: " + newFile.getAbsolutePath());
类图
classDiagram
class File{
File()
getPath(): String
}
甘特图
gantt
title 实现"java根据路径得到file"任务甘特图
section 整体流程
创建File对象: done, 2022-01-01, 1d
获取路径字符串: done, after 创建File对象, 1d
根据路径字符串创建File对象: done, after 获取路径字符串, 1d
判断File对象是否存在: done, after 根据路径字符串创建File对象, 1d
输出File对象的信息: done, after 判断File对象是否存在, 1d
通过以上步骤和代码,希望我所提供的信息能够帮助你理解如何实现“java根据路径得到file”。如果还有任何疑问或需要进一步帮助,欢迎随时向我提出。祝你学习进步!